Just dropped my MH registration into the ULEZ checker and been informed that the vehicle is not compliant. It's a 22 plate Burstner coachbuilt on a Ducato cab. The website states it has to be Euro 6 to be compliant. My V5C states it is Euro VI E. So compliant in my book. Anyone else had this issue and is there a process to correct this?

The reason they put the cameras on the traffic lights is because councils which are opposed to the expansion do not allow new camera sites, but TFL own the traffic lights so they don't need permission to put them on the lights.
